I am looking for an exceptional, experienced Housekeeper/Maintenance couple for a fantastic new live in role for a private residence in Hampshire.

Applicants must have proven private household experience working together as a couple, be fluent in English, have an enthusiastic and proactive approach and the wherewithal to hit the ground running.

You will be joining a professional, friendly team who all work cohesively to serve the principals seamlessly. The house will mainly be the weekend residence and there will be some assistance in other properties on occasion, therefore flexibility is key. Duties include, but are not limited to:

MAINTENANCE:
- Ensure security of residence at all times  
- Looking after the dogs
- Perform cleaning activities such as dusting and mopping
- General minor maintenance where required (there is a wider maintenance team)
- Collaborating with contractors for special projects
- Manage the fleet of cars (MOT, valet of cars, general up keeping)
- Driving for Principals (there are full time drivers based elsewhere)
- Maintenance of pool
- Assisting the Estate Manager with infrastructure services
- Inventories of all cleaning material, maintenance tools etc
- Assist Head Gardener where needed
- Assist Housekeepers where needed

HOUSEKEEPING:
- Ensure the highest level of cleanliness and organization of all interior areas
- Turn down/ turn up service
- Cleaning and regular service of guest staterooms and guest areas ensuring the highest standards
- Responsible for the maintenance of all artwork, surfaces, amenities, fixtures, furnishings, fabrics,
- Assisting the House Manager as required and directed
- Daily cleaning duties in staff areas, monitoring and restock of staff supplies, maintaining general cleanliness in all staff areas
- Ensure that all resident personal clothing is ironed and pressed as requested to maintain high standard of finished articles
- Ensure prompt, efficient and error free; sorting, cleaning, stain removal, and pressing of all laundry items including: Staff linens, towels, personal clothing, kitchen towels and service laundry etc
- Monitoring of any work or maintenance performed in the laundry
- Detailed cleaning of laundry, laundry machinery and storage areas, and other interior areas
- Assist with unpacking of all provisioning
- Assist with interior inventory and stock take when required
- Monitor laundry supplies and provide Estate Manager with low stock inventory report
- Light cooking (Breakfast, Lunch and Dinner) for the Principals.  A Chef will be brought in when there are guests

You will be working  5 days a week, including weekends, with some flexibility. Accommodation is a beautifully presented 2 bedroom cottage. Due the rural location and light driving requirements, applicants must have full clean driving licences.
